Understanding Player Limits: A Deep Dive

Player limits are the cornerstone of responsible gambling. They are customizable restrictions that you set to manage your spending and gaming activity. These limits are designed to help you stay within your budget and prevent impulsive behaviour. Let’s explore the different types of limits available:

Deposit Limits

Deposit limits are perhaps the most fundamental. They allow you to set a maximum amount you can deposit into your casino account over a specific period, such as daily, weekly, or monthly. This is a crucial tool for controlling your spending and preventing yourself from chasing losses. By setting a deposit limit, you predetermine the maximum amount you’re willing to risk, ensuring that your gambling remains within your financial means. Consider your income, expenses, and other financial commitments when setting your deposit limits.

Loss Limits

Loss limits allow you to set a maximum amount you are willing to lose within a specific timeframe. Once you reach this limit, your account will be restricted from placing further bets until the limit resets. This is a powerful tool for preventing significant financial losses and protecting your bankroll. It’s important to be realistic when setting loss limits and to consider the volatility of the games you play. Higher volatility games may lead to more frequent losses, and therefore, you might want to set a more conservative loss limit.

Wager Limits

Wager limits control the total amount you can wager over a given period. This limit helps you manage the volume of your betting activity and can be particularly useful for players who tend to place numerous bets. Similar to deposit and loss limits, wager limits can be set on a daily, weekly, or monthly basis. By monitoring your total wagers, you can gain a clearer understanding of your overall gambling expenditure and adjust your limits accordingly.

Session Time Limits

Session time limits restrict the amount of time you spend playing in a single session. This is a valuable tool for preventing excessive gaming and ensuring you take regular breaks. When the session time limit is reached, you will be automatically logged out of your account, preventing you from continuing to play until the restriction resets. This can help prevent fatigue and impulsive decision-making, allowing you to approach your gaming with a clearer mind.

Account Control Features: Beyond the Limits

Beyond the core player limits, online casinos offer a range of account control features designed to support responsible gambling. These features provide additional layers of protection and give you greater control over your gaming activity:

Reality Checks

Reality checks are pop-up reminders that appear at regular intervals during your gaming sessions. These reminders inform you of the time you’ve spent playing and the amount you’ve won or lost. Reality checks help you stay aware of your gaming activity and prevent you from losing track of time. They encourage you to take breaks and reassess your gaming behaviour.

Self-Exclusion

Self-exclusion is a powerful tool that allows you to temporarily or permanently restrict your access to a casino’s platform. This feature is designed for players who feel they are losing control of their gambling. Self-exclusion periods can range from a few months to several years. During this time, the casino will block your access to your account and will take steps to prevent you from opening new accounts. This is a serious step, and you should carefully consider its implications before initiating self-exclusion.

Transaction History

Reviewing your transaction history is a crucial part of responsible gambling. Most online casinos provide detailed records of your deposits, withdrawals, wagers, and winnings. By regularly reviewing your transaction history, you can track your spending, identify any patterns of problematic behaviour, and make informed decisions about your gambling habits. This information can also be helpful if you need to seek support from a gambling counselling service.

Account Activity Notifications

Some casinos offer account activity notifications, which can be sent via email or SMS. These notifications can alert you to significant account activity, such as large deposits, withdrawals, or changes to your account settings. This can help you monitor your account for any unauthorized activity and ensure that your account is secure.

Practical Recommendations: Putting Control into Action

Implementing player limits and account control features is a proactive step towards responsible gambling. Here are some practical recommendations:

  • Set Realistic Limits: Before you start playing, carefully assess your financial situation and set deposit, loss, and wager limits that you can comfortably afford.
  • Utilize Session Time Limits: Set time limits to prevent excessive gaming and ensure you take regular breaks.
  • Activate Reality Checks: Enable reality checks to stay aware of your gaming activity and avoid losing track of time.
  • Review Your Transaction History Regularly: Monitor your spending and identify any patterns of problematic behaviour.
  • Consider Self-Exclusion if Needed: If you feel you are losing control, don’t hesitate to utilize the self-exclusion feature.
  • Explore Additional Resources: Familiarize yourself with the resources available, such as gambling support helplines and websites.
  • Regularly Review and Adjust: Review your limits and account settings regularly, and adjust them as needed to reflect any changes in your financial situation or gaming habits.
